0
Spin a Win Wild from Playtech Live
Spin a Win Wild from Playtech Live Marketing Materials available are here:
Like Follow
Reply
Spin a Win Wild from Playtech Live Marketing Materials available are here:
Games Roadmap
Promotions Roadmap
Providers
Marketing&Promo Tools